What is an Air Fryer?

Before we dive into the specifics of air frying Red Robin steak fries, let’s first understand what an air fryer is. An air fryer is a kitchen appliance that uses hot air in combination with a small amount of oil to cook food. It works by circulating hot air around the food at high speeds, creating a crispy exterior while locking in moisture and flavor.

Air fryers have become increasingly popular due to their ability to produce crispy and delicious food without the excess oil and calories associated with traditional frying methods. They also require less time and effort than using a deep fryer or traditional oven.

Preparing the Fries

The key to making perfect Red Robin steak fries in an air fryer is proper preparation. Start by scrubbing and rinsing 4-5 large russet potatoes under cold water. Thoroughly dry them with paper towels or a clean kitchen towel.

Next, cut the potatoes into wedges, about 1/2 inch thick. If you prefer thinner fries, you can slice them into smaller pieces. It’s important to make sure that all of your slices are similar in size so they cook evenly in the air fryer.

Once you have all your fries cut, place them in a bowl and toss with 1-2 tablespoons of oil (we recommend vegetable or avocado oil) until they are evenly coated. This will help them crisp up in the air fryer.

Seasoning the Fries

Red Robin steak fries are known for their delicious blend of seasonings. To recreate this flavor at home, you will need 1 tablespoon of garlic powder, 1 tablespoon of smoked paprika, 1 teaspoon of seasoned salt, and 1 teaspoon of black pepper. Mix these seasonings together in a small bowl.

Sprinkle the seasoning mixture over the oiled fries and toss until they are evenly coated. This will give your fries that signature Red Robin flavor.

Air Frying Process

Now comes the fun part – air frying! Preheat your air fryer to 400°F for about 5 minutes. Once it’s heated, place your seasoned fries in a single layer in the basket of the air fryer. It’s important not to overcrowd the basket as this will prevent proper airflow and result in unevenly cooked fries.

Cook the fries for about 15 minutes, shaking the basket halfway through to ensure even cooking. Cooking times may vary depending on your air fryer, so keep an eye on them towards the end to avoid burning.

Tips for Preparing Red Robin Steak Fries for Air Frying

Before you start cooking your Red Robin steak fries in the air fryer, there are a few steps you can take to ensure they turn out perfect every time. First, make sure your fries are cut into thick, uniform pieces to ensure even cooking. Soaking them in cold water for 30 minutes will also help remove excess starch and result in crispier fries.

Dry the fries thoroughly before adding them to the air fryer basket, as any excess moisture can create steam and prevent the fries from crisping up. It’s essential to preheat your air fryer for a few minutes before adding the fries to get that perfect crunchy texture.

The Best Way to Air Fry Red Robin Steak Fries

Once you’ve prepped your steak fries, it’s time to cook them in the air fryer. The ideal temperature for cooking these fries is 400°F (200°C). You can either use a preset on your air fryer or manually set the temperature and time. Keep in mind that every air fryer is different, so it may take a few tries to get the perfect cooking time for your model.

Another crucial step in getting crispy and evenly cooked steak fries is shaking or flipping them halfway through cooking. This will help ensure that all sides of the fries are exposed to hot air and will prevent any burnt spots.

Alternative Ways to Season Red Robin Steak Fries

While Red Robin steak fries are delicious on their own, there are many ways you can experiment with different seasonings for a twist on this classic side dish. Here are some ideas:

– Garlic parmesan: Toss the cooked steak fries with garlic powder, dried parsley, and grated parmesan cheese.
– Ranch seasoning: Sprinkle a packet of ranch seasoning over the uncooked steak fries before air frying them.
– Cajun spice: Add some heat by mixing Cajun seasoning with oil or melted butter and tossing it with the uncooked steak fries.
– Chili lime: Squeeze fresh lime juice over cooked steak fries and sprinkle chili powder and a pinch of salt for a tangy and spicy combination.
